    Originally posted by: BigDog68 on 6/8/2007 8:25:02 PM


    That's what we are doing here in Ohio. We have our "planning meetings" at different locations around the state, which is picked by a different member each time. There are no "dues" in a state chapter, as your NAFC dues are already paid for. Start out small like we did, we set up a "meeting" at an area resturant that had a large banquet room for groups, we had breakfast and then had our meeting afterwards. We then had nominations for officers and elected them in which is a one year term. After we got the groundwork set up for the Ohio Chapter, we started making plans on our first Ohio Meet. Most of us donated some money to put in the general fund, then we purchased rolls of raffle tickets at the local Wal-Mart and started getting sponsors and donors to donate items for a raffle and started selling tickets to raise funds for the chapter. We even raffled off 3 Fishing Charter Trips from PlayinHooky Charters & Rising Sun Charters, both here in Ohio. If you have any questions, feel free to drop in the Ohio page and ask, we'll be glad to help out. Good Luck to you & we look forward to seeing a Minnesota Chapter get started up in the near future.
